CEMA Campus | Formación profesional BIM para Arquitectura, Ingeniería y Construcción

OffOn
0

Shopping cart

Close

No hay productos en el carrito.

Programador BIM con la API de Revit

Categorías: BIM
Lista de deseos Compartir

Acerca de este curso

Aprende a automatizar Autodesk Revit desde cero utilizando Dynamo, Python y C#. Domina Revit API y desarrolla tus propios Add-ins profesionales para transformar procesos BIM.

¿Qué aprenderás?

  • Crear automatizaciones BIM con Dynamo desde nivel básico hasta avanzado.
  • Desarrollar algoritmos visuales aplicados a Autodesk Revit.
  • Automatizar procesos de modelado, documentación y gestión BIM.
  • Programar scripts avanzados utilizando Python dentro de Dynamo.
  • Conectar Python con Revit API para controlar elementos del modelo.
  • Manipular parámetros, familias, vistas y geometrías mediante código.
  • Dominar los fundamentos del lenguaje C# aplicado a BIM.
  • Crear Add-ins profesionales para Autodesk Revit.
  • Desarrollar interfaces gráficas con WPF.
  • Utilizar Visual Studio y herramientas profesionales de desarrollo.
  • Extraer información BIM hacia Excel y otras plataformas.
  • Crear soluciones para arquitectura, estructuras y MEP.
  • Empaquetar y distribuir tus propias herramientas BIM.

Contenido del curso

Módulo 01: Introducción al Desarrollo y Automatización BIM
Comprende los fundamentos de la programación aplicada al entorno BIM y cómo Dynamo, Python y C# permiten automatizar procesos dentro de Autodesk Revit. Se explicará el flujo completo para convertirse en BIM Automation Developer.

  • 01. ¿Qué es la programación BIM?
  • 02. Rol del BIM Developer en la industria AEC
  • 03. Automatización de procesos en Autodesk Revit
  • 04. Programación visual vs programación tradicional
  • 05. Flujo Dynamo → Python → Revit API → C#
  • 06. Instalación del entorno de trabajo
  • 07. Ejemplos reales de automatización BIM

Módulo 02: Dynamo Básico para Autodesk Revit
Aprende los fundamentos de Dynamo como herramienta de programación visual para crear tus primeras automatizaciones y controlar información dentro de modelos BIM.

Módulo 03: Dynamo Intermedio aplicado a Revit
Desarrolla automatizaciones BIM conectando Dynamo directamente con Autodesk Revit para modificar elementos, parámetros y documentación del proyecto.

Módulo 04: Python aplicado a Dynamo y Revit API
Introduce la programación textual mediante Python para superar las limitaciones de Dynamo y acceder directamente a funciones avanzadas de Revit API.

Módulo 05: Fundamentos de C# para Revit API
Aprende las bases del lenguaje C# orientadas al desarrollo profesional de complementos para Autodesk Revit utilizando Visual Studio.

Módulo 06: Desarrollo con C# y Revit API
Domina las principales clases y métodos de Revit API para consultar, modificar y crear información BIM mediante programación profesional.

Módulo 07: Geometría y Automatización avanzada con API
Aprende a trabajar con geometría interna de Revit para desarrollar herramientas avanzadas de análisis, creación y modificación de modelos BIM.

Módulo 08: Desarrollo Profesional de Add-ins BIM
Construye aplicaciones BIM profesionales con interfaces gráficas, organización avanzada de código y distribución comercial.

Proyecto Final: Desarrollo de una Suite BIM
Desarrolla una aplicación completa para Autodesk Revit integrando Dynamo, Python, C#, WPF y Revit API en un flujo profesional.

Valoraciones y reseñas de estudiantes

Aún no hay reseñas.
Aún no hay reseñas.